So… how did the owner of a marketing company that builds global brands for others become the founder of BabySpa®, a natural bath and body care line for children?

Well, while not your typical story, let me share how it all came about. Working in a fast paced environment with women, some pregnant, some single, some moms and with the upcoming birth of one of our chief graphic artist’s baby girl, a lot of discussion was tossed around about baby care products in the market. While there were a few good products with different attributes, it seemed like none truly encompassed all of the traits they would like to see in a baby skin care collection.

After months of passionate discussions, we decided to take upon ourselves the challenge of digging deeper into the subject and applied our marketing research know-how to seek and identify what busy moms need and desire. After spending endless hours sifting through hundreds of published pediatric dermatology white papers, conducting interviews and focus groups with moms, and testing dozens of popular baby care products in the market, the results were clear: There was not a single product line that fulfilled all of the demands of health- conscious parents.

Armed with this information, we consulted renowned European research labs and expert dermatologists who confirmed the need for a more sensible baby care product collection that addressed the specific skin care needs of babies as they grow and are exposed to different environmental factors. We met with botanical experts to find natural, organic and effective ingredients that are ECOCERT® certified. We partnered with the highest quality Swiss labs and cosmetic manufacturers to help us develop our smooth and silky textures, signature fresh scents, and eco-friendly products with ethnobotanicals that promote healthy skin.

Three years later, we are excited to make our BabySpa® products available to the moms who have made this possible, and to all of the parents out there seeking easy-to-use and effective skin care products for their babies.
